Transaction 58e66ae63f19dc3d9b4928ef9dbcce53f6ae949d9434963a9fe59e5e3afd31ee

1 Input
2 Outputs
  • 58e66ae63f19dc3d9b4928ef9dbcce53f6ae949d9434963a9fe59e5e3afd31ee:0
  • value  1749825
    address  17bYAKcvwDDfYuRmoBDDsc6YmZUh6Wvwby
  • 58e66ae63f19dc3d9b4928ef9dbcce53f6ae949d9434963a9fe59e5e3afd31ee:1
  • value  564880875
    address  1N2yMtz8UhEPFQekucjnQSZyRwACWbYSnK